About Neurocrine Biosciences Inc

Neurocrine Biosciences,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company focused on discovering, developing, and commercializing innovative treatments for neurological, endocrine, and psychiatric disorders. The company's portfolio targets conditions such as tardive dyskinesia, endometriosis, and Parkinson's disease. NBIX leverages its expertise in neurobiology and small-molecule drug development to address diseases with significant unmet medical needs.

About Sanofi SA

Sanofi develops and markets drugs with a concentration in oncology, immunology, c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and vaccines. However, the company's decision in late 2019 to pull back from the cardio-metabolic area will likely reduce the firm's footprint in this large therapeutic area. The company offers a diverse array of drugs with its highest revenue generator, Dupixent, representing just over 10% of total sales, but profits are shared with Regeneron. About 30% of total revenue comes from the United States and 25% from Europe. Emerging markets represent the majority of the remainder of revenue.
